The list was compiled from the many different
audience and critic's polls that are shown on the greatest
lists page as well as lists compiled by regular contributors to
SBwebspace.com. Voting came to an end in April 2008 and the results were
first published on the 1st May 2008.
View Results ~ We are not, of course, going to arrogantly suggest this is the most definitive of all film lists. The purpose of these sorts of polls is to stimulate healthy debate and to get people thinking about what makes a great film. Perhaps unsurprisingly, it is Orson Welles's Citizen Kane that took top spot in the poll as the film has consistently topped a variety of different types of film lists over the last sixty years. Alfred Hitchcock has the highest number of films in the list with 11. Steven Spielberg has 10 even though he has only one entry in the top 100 (Schindler's List - 19). Stanley Kubrick has 9 with both 2001 (4) and Dr. Strangelove (20) in the top 20. Akira Kurosawa has 8 in the list with Seven Samurai (8) and Rashomon (21) well placed. Others: 7 Films - Luis Bunuel, Billy Wilder, Robert Bresson, Martin Scorsese, 6 - Jean Luc-Godard, John Ford, Howard Hawks, Charles Chaplin, Federico Fellini, 5 - Ingmar Bergman, Orson Welles, Michael Powell, Michelangelo Antonioni, Jean Renoir, F.W. Murnau. |
